Hotel Seikoen, Nikko
Overview
Featuring Wi-Fi in public areas, Hotel Seikoen Nikko sits an 8-minute walk from Shagohyo. This hotel is 3.1 km from Kirifuri Waterfall and provides guests with a hot spring public bath and a sauna.
Location
Located right near Tobu Nikko railway station, the 3-star ryokan stands in the vicinity of Shinkyo Bridge. The property also gives access to Futarasan Shrine, which is a 9-minute walk away.
The hotel stands 350 metres from Nikkozan Rinnoji Temple.
Hotel Seikoen-mae bus stop lies a 10-minute stroll away.
Rooms
The Seikoen welcomes guests to 25 rooms complete with high-speed internet and a flat-screen TV with satellite channels, as well as comforts like climate control. Self-catering facilities include an electric kettle and a refrigerator. Featuring a bathtub, a separate toilet, and a shower, the bathrooms also have a hairdryer and bath sheets. They offer views of the mountain.
Eat & Drink
This Nikko property invites guests to the lounge bar to relax with a drink. The bar area includes a lounge. The café Ueshima Coffee Shop is 250 metres away.
Leisure & Business
The Seikoen Nikko offers a shared lounge, karaoke, and various recreational opportunities to make your stay more enjoyable.
